This recipe was extracted from With a saucepan over the sea (1902) by Adelaide Keen, page 73.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.
CURRANT LOZENGES. (England.) Cook 3 quarts of ripe currants with a little water, bruising until soft. Press out all the juice, add J^ pound of sugar to each pint, simmer j^ hour, add j4 ounce of gelatine
